City Manager Mr. McCartt thanked the city employees that have already been working on and will be working on Funfest for events which usually extends beyond their regular workday. 2. Mayor and Board Members Alderman Mayes mentioned Healthy Kingsport launched a new website last week and encouraged citizens to view the activities and resources there. He also stated the Friday night concerts were a success with great attendance. He thanked city employees for funfest efforts, noting its shaping up to be the biggest since the pandemic. Alderman Cooper commented on the presentation yesterday by Robin Cleary and the grants that were awarded downtown. She also stated DKA has partnered with MeadowView and Christmas trees have already gone on sale with half already sold. Lastly she mentioned that school will be in session by the next BMA Page 11 of 12 BOARD OF MAYOR AND ALDERMEN BUSINESS MEETING MINUTES Tuesday, July 15, 2025 at 7: 00 PM Kingsport City Hall, 415 Broad Street, Boardroom meeting, remarking summer is almost over and encouraged citizens to go out and enjoy Funfest. Alderman George said she was excited to talk about Christman again. She also mentioned the celebration for the carousel, noting it's hard to believe it has been around for ten years and pointing out the number of volunteers that made it happen. She commented on the great Funfest presentation at the work session yesterday, noting the new events and 20 balloonists that will be coming in. Alderman Baker thanked the City Manager for adding the strategic focus area to the action form. He also commented that funfest has been around 45 years, and he remembers the first one. He recognized city staffs involvement and thanked the city manager. Alderman Phillips also commented on the carousel with a birthday party and free rides on Saturday. They will also be unveiling a new animal. He also talked about funfest. Vice Mayor Duncan recognized Mayor Montgomery for being accepted to Leadership Tennessee. He also mentioned Funfest, noting 35 states are represented and the economic impact it provides. He stated the Carousel is a legacy project and a crown jewel of Kingsport. Mayor Montgomery reminded everyone of the international pageant this weekend. He also stated he attended the graduation at the Northeast Tennessee recovery center and the community support represented. Lastly the mayor recognized newly appointed Police Chief Bellamy. XIV.
